Is Apache an Open Source Web Server?

When it comes to web servers, Apache is a name that often comes up. But what exactly is Apache, and is it an open source web server? In this article, we will explore the ins and outs of Apache and its open source nature.

What is Apache?

Apache HTTP Server, commonly referred to as just Apache, is a powerful web server software that has been around since 1995. It was initially developed by the Apache Software Foundation and has since become one of the most popular web servers available.

Apache is known for its stability, flexibility, and security features. It supports various operating systems, including Windows, macOS, Linux, and Unix-like systems. With its modular architecture, it allows users to extend its functionality by adding modules for specific needs.

Open Source Nature

Open source software refers to software that is freely available for anyone to use, modify, and distribute. The source code of open source software can be accessed by anyone, promoting transparency and collaboration among developers.

Apache is indeed an open source web server. It is released under the Apache License, which allows users to freely use and distribute the software without any licensing fees. Additionally, the license permits modification of the source code to suit specific requirements.

The Benefits of Open Source

The open source nature of Apache brings several benefits:

  • Flexibility: Users have the freedom to customize and configure Apache according to their specific needs.
  • Security: With a large community of developers continuously reviewing the source code, security vulnerabilities can be identified and addressed promptly.
  • Community Support: Being open source means Apache has a vast community of users and developers who can provide support, share knowledge, and contribute to the improvement of the software.


In conclusion, Apache is an open source web server that offers stability, flexibility, and security. Its open source nature allows users to customize it to suit their requirements and benefit from a vibrant community of contributors. Whether you are a beginner or an experienced web developer, Apache is a reliable choice for hosting your websites.

So next time you hear about Apache, remember that it’s more than just a web server – it’s an open source powerhouse!

